It's been a long 3 weeks here in hell. I just got power a few days ago and I fixed my own phone line down the road, a tree stump took it out. My wife says " you know you're a redneck when you sit on the side of the road and fix your own phone line". Phone company said that the repair date was December 13.
I don't think anybody was prepared for this beast, including myself. Our farm has hundreds of 100+ year old trees down everwhere. This place looks pretty bare now, or maybe I should say more like a war zone. All of our buildings are still up, besides a few sheets of metal here and there. My moblie home is still standing which is a surprise, because their are alot of moblie homes destroyed. 1 mile down the road there is a moblie home and all thats left is the floor and frame, so I think I'm damn lucky.
I've learned alot in the past 3 weeks, like who really are my friends and who are not. Sometimes some family members can be a pain in the ass. I hope my children and I never have to go through a storm like this ever again.
It's going to take years to get over this, but right now we're taking it just one day at a time. It could have been a lot worse though, I wasn't stuck in a attic or on a roof for days.
